2009-07-23 108 views
3

我想創建一個鏈接到一個URL,如首頁/細節/ 1在jqGrid列。ASP.NET MVC路由與jqGrid

文檔顯示: showlink {baseLinkUrl: '',的showAction: '顯示',addParam:」 &鍵= 2' }注意:addParam應包含&。

例如: 格式化: 'showlink',formatoptions:{baseLinkUrl: 'someurl.php',addParam: '&行動=編輯'} 這將輸出:HTTP://本地主機/ someurl.php ID = 123 & action =編輯

有沒有人使用格式化程序來創建路線而不是querystrings?

+0

你會請你發佈你的解決方案嗎? – 2011-02-20 02:35:02

回答

0

我還沒有使用過jqGrid,但據我所知,你不應該爲addParam設置任何東西,因爲那隻會將它追加爲一個QueryString。嘗試設置您的路線到baseLinkUrl

+0

{name:'ID',index:'ID',width:80,align:'left',formatter:'showlink',formatoptions:{baseLinkUrl:'/ home/details /'}}, Results in: home/details/show?id = 2undefined 問題是如何附加ID baseLinkUrl。並擺脫undefined – Danny 2009-07-23 09:32:13